什么叫表格数据库建模工具
-
表格数据库建模工具是一种用于创建和管理数据库的工具,它主要用于将现有的数据组织成表格形式,并定义表格之间的关系和约束。通过使用表格数据库建模工具,用户可以快速而准确地设计数据库结构,创建表格、字段和约束,并管理数据库的数据。
以下是表格数据库建模工具的一些主要功能和特点:
-
可视化建模:表格数据库建模工具通常提供直观的用户界面,允许用户通过拖拽和放置的方式创建表格、字段和关系。用户可以使用工具中提供的各种图标和符号来表示不同的数据库对象,从而更清晰地展示数据库结构。
-
数据类型支持:表格数据库建模工具通常支持多种数据类型,如整数、字符串、日期、布尔值等。用户可以根据需要选择合适的数据类型,并设置字段的长度、精度和约束,以确保数据的一致性和完整性。
-
关系建立:表格数据库建模工具提供了创建和管理表格之间关系的功能。用户可以定义主键、外键、一对一、一对多和多对多等关系,以建立表格之间的连接和约束。这样可以确保数据的一致性,并提高查询和操作的效率。
-
约束和验证:表格数据库建模工具允许用户定义各种约束和验证规则,以确保数据的完整性和有效性。例如,用户可以定义字段的唯一性约束、非空约束、范围约束等,以限制输入的数据范围和格式。
-
逆向工程:表格数据库建模工具通常支持从现有的数据库或数据源中逆向生成数据库模型的功能。用户可以通过连接到数据库,将已有的表格和字段导入到建模工具中,并根据需要进行修改和优化。
总之,表格数据库建模工具是一种强大的工具,它可以帮助用户快速、准确地设计和管理数据库。它的可视化建模、关系建立、约束和验证等功能使得数据库的设计和维护变得更加简单和高效。
1年前 -
-
表格数据库建模工具是一种用于设计和管理关系型数据库的工具,它可以帮助用户在建立数据库时更加高效和准确地进行数据建模。这些工具通常提供了丰富的功能和界面,使用户可以通过图形界面来设计数据库的表结构、定义表之间的关系、设置字段类型和约束条件等。
表格数据库建模工具的主要功能包括:
-
实体关系图设计:通过图形界面,用户可以创建实体关系图,用于表示数据库中的表和它们之间的关系。用户可以通过拖拽和连接来创建表和关系,并可以设置各种属性和约束条件。
-
数据类型定义:工具提供了丰富的数据类型供用户选择,如整数、字符、日期、布尔等。用户可以根据实际需求选择合适的数据类型,并可以设置字段长度、精度、默认值等属性。
-
约束条件设置:用户可以定义各种约束条件,如主键、外键、唯一约束、非空约束等。工具会根据用户的设置自动生成相应的SQL语句,以确保数据的完整性和一致性。
-
数据库逆向工程:工具可以根据已有的数据库或SQL脚本生成相应的实体关系图,帮助用户快速了解和分析现有数据库的结构。
-
数据库文档生成:工具可以根据数据库的结构和元数据生成相应的文档,包括表结构、字段定义、约束条件、索引等信息。这些文档可以用于数据库开发和维护的参考。
-
版本管理:一些高级的表格数据库建模工具还提供了版本管理功能,允许用户对数据库的结构进行版本控制和变更管理,以便更好地进行团队协作和追踪变更历史。
总之,表格数据库建模工具可以帮助用户更加方便和高效地设计和管理关系型数据库,提高开发效率和数据质量,减少错误和冲突。它们是数据库开发和维护过程中不可或缺的工具之一。
1年前 -
-
表格数据库建模工具是一种用于创建和管理数据库模型的工具。它可以帮助用户以图形化的方式设计数据库结构,并自动生成相应的表格和关系。这样,用户可以更轻松地创建和维护数据库,而不需要直接编写和执行SQL语句。
表格数据库建模工具通常具有以下主要功能:
-
数据模型设计:用户可以使用工具中提供的图形界面设计数据库模型。它通常包括实体、属性和关系的定义,以及其他约束和索引的设置。
-
自动化代码生成:工具可以根据用户设计的数据库模型自动生成相应的SQL语句或其他编程代码。这样,用户可以更快地创建数据库表格和关系,并减少错误的可能性。
-
数据库连接和管理:工具可以与各种数据库管理系统(如MySQL、Oracle、SQL Server等)进行连接,并提供管理数据库的功能,如创建、修改和删除表格、执行查询语句等。
-
数据模型验证和优化:工具可以对用户设计的数据库模型进行验证,以确保其符合数据库设计原则和最佳实践。它还可以提供性能优化建议,以提高数据库的查询和操作效率。
-
版本控制和团队协作:一些表格数据库建模工具支持版本控制和团队协作功能,允许多个用户同时编辑数据库模型,并跟踪和管理其变更历史。
使用表格数据库建模工具的一般流程如下:
-
安装和配置工具:首先,用户需要下载并安装所选择的表格数据库建模工具,并根据需要进行配置。这可能涉及到指定数据库管理系统的连接信息、选择默认的代码生成选项等。
-
创建数据模型:用户可以使用工具提供的图形界面,在工作区中设计数据库模型。这通常包括创建实体、定义属性和关系,以及设置约束和索引。
-
生成数据库脚本:一旦数据库模型设计完成,用户可以使用工具提供的代码生成功能,自动生成相应的数据库脚本。这些脚本可以是SQL语句,也可以是其他编程语言的代码。
-
执行数据库脚本:用户将生成的数据库脚本执行到目标数据库管理系统中。这可以通过工具提供的连接和管理功能,或者直接使用数据库管理系统的命令行工具完成。
-
验证和优化数据库模型:用户可以使用工具提供的验证和优化功能,对数据库模型进行检查和优化。这可以帮助用户发现和修复潜在的设计问题,并提高数据库的性能和可靠性。
-
部署和管理数据库:一旦数据库模型验证通过并优化完毕,用户可以将其部署到生产环境中,并使用工具提供的管理功能对数据库进行日常维护和管理。
需要注意的是,不同的表格数据库建模工具可能具有不同的功能和操作流程。因此,在选择和使用工具时,用户应该根据自己的需求和技术背景进行评估和比较,以找到最适合自己的工具。
1年前 -